WebWhile the EPA did introduce stricter regulations regarding wood-burning stoves and open fireplaces in 2014, the usage of these appliances is not outright banned in the US. However, on the state and local levels, different jurisdictions have banned wood-burning appliances, especially in California. WebAll wood burning appliances (even if certified) may only burn clean, dry, untreated wood. Materials that shall not be burned include: whole tree stumps (must be chipped), tires, chemicals, plastic, construction debris, and trash.
